For the 2025 school year, there are 11 public preschools serving 5,112 students in Broomfield, CO.
The top ranked public preschools in Broomfield, CO are Thunder Vista P-8, Kohl Elementary School and Aspen Creek K-8 School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Broomfield, CO public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 43% (versus the Colorado public pre school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 53% (versus the 42% statewide average). Pre schools in Broomfield have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Colorado public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 38%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Colorado public preschool average of 52% (majority Hispanic).
